Carteret County Board of Commissioners Provides Funding to Sidney Dive Team | Eastern North Carolina Now

Press Release:

(Carteret County Commissioner Chris Chadwick, left, and Beaufort County Deputy Director of Emergency Services Chris Newkirk, right)


    March 9, 2022     At the March 7, 2022 regular meeting of the Beaufort County Board of Commissioners, Commissioner Chris Chadwick, on behalf of the Carteret County Board of Commissioners, presented a $12,000 check for the Sidney Dive Team to purchase an additional diving helmet so that the Team could expand its abilities to conduct underwater search/rescue/recovery operations.

    The Sidney Dive Team is a highly specialized volunteer dive team that provides underwater search/rescue/recovery operations. The Team recently assisted in recovery operations from the tragic airplane crash off the coast of Drum Inlet in Carteret County that claimed the lives of four sophomores from East Carteret High School and four adults on February 13, 2022. The group was returning from a duck hunting trip to Hyde County when their plane went down.

    Commissioner Chadwick expressed his appreciation to the Sidney Dive Team members for their efforts. He stated that the Team was, "efficient, well equipped and very compassionate folks" and "we are indebted to them gratefully." He further stated that they "were a blessing to our county and community and we are very appreciative to them."
